Changes in hyaluronan production and metabolism following ischaemic stroke in man
Ahmed Al'Qteishat,John Gaffney,Jerzy Krupinski,Francisco Rubio,David C. West,Shant Kumar,Patricia Kumar,Nicholas Mitsios,Mark Slevin +8 more
TL;DR: It is found that the production of total HA and low molecular mass 3-10 disaccharides of HA (o-HA) was increased in post-mortem tissue and in the serum of patients 1, 3, 7 and 14 days after ischaemic stroke.

Anoctamin 2 identified as an autoimmune target in multiple sclerosis
Burcu Ayoglu,Nicholas Mitsios,Ingrid Kockum,Mohsen Khademi,Arash Zandian,Ronald Sjöberg,Björn Forsström,Johan Bredenberg,Izaura Lima Bomfim,Erik Holmgren,Hans Grönlund,André Ortlieb Guerreiro-Cacais,Nada Abdelmagid,Mathias Uhlén,Tim Waterboer,Lars Alfredsson,Lars Alfredsson,Jan Mulder,Jochen M. Schwenk,Tomas Olsson,Peter Nilsson +20 more
TL;DR: The findings presented here demonstrate that an ANO2 autoimmune subphenotype may exist in MS and lay the groundwork for further studies focusing on the pathogenic role of ANO1 autoantibodies in MS.
